## Add debounced occupancy feed for Garage Westhaven

This PR wires the Westhaven garage sensor stream into the Stallwatch ingestion service. New team members: note that raw gate counts arrive out of order, so we buffer and debounce before publishing. Validation rejects negative deltas and stale timestamps beyond the window. The behavior is governed by the tuning constants below.

tuning table, yajog-yahof:
BUDGETS = {
    "lamvan": 303,
    "wenox": 460,
    "fenvan": 525,
}

Subject: Quickstore 4.2 — bloom filter now fronts the KV layer

Plugin authors: starting with this release, Quickstore places a bloom filter ahead of the key-value store. Negative lookups return faster; false positives fall through safely. No API changes are required on your side. Verify your plugin against the staging build referenced below.

session token of fahif-tadup = htk3_9c7

Handover note — Crumbwheel order cutoffs.

Welcome aboard. The bakery cutoff rule in Crumbwheel closes same-day orders at 14:00 local to each storefront, not UTC — this has bitten us twice. Holiday overrides live in the calendar service and take precedence silently, so always check there first when a cutoff looks wrong. To unlock the calendar service's admin console after a restart, enter the recovery passphrase below.

vault phrase of bagap-bahaf = silion-pelox-sorox-casdor-quenwyn-fraax-eliox-praael-kelion-quenvan-kasox-rusael-norius-belvan